In-depth Feature Analysis
NeuralLink AI Assistant stands out in the crowded smart device market thanks to its unique blend of features:
- Context-Aware AI: Unlike conventional assistants, NeuralLink leverages deep contextual understanding to anticipate user needs, providing proactive suggestions and reminders.
- Multi-modal Interaction: Supports seamless voice commands, gesture recognition, and even eye-tracking inputs for hands-free control in any environment.
- Privacy-first Architecture: Employs edge computing to process sensitive data locally, minimizing reliance on cloud servers and enhancing user privacy.
- Cross-Platform Integration: Compatible with a wide range of smart home devices, calendars, emails, and workplace productivity apps, ensuring a unified user experience.
- Adaptive Learning: Continuously learns from user behavior to customize responses, workflows, and even suggest optimizations for daily routines.
Device Specs Comparison Table
Feature | NeuralLink AI Assistant | Competitor A | Competitor B |
---|---|---|---|
Processor | Hexa-core Neural Engine 3.0 | Quad-core AI Chip | Octa-core Processor |
Memory | 8GB LPDDR5 | 6GB DDR4 | 8GB DDR4 |
Storage | 128GB SSD | 64GB eMMC | 128GB SSD |
Connectivity | Wi-Fi 6E, Bluetooth 5.2, 5G | Wi-Fi 5, Bluetooth 5.0 | Wi-Fi 6, Bluetooth 5.1 |
Input Methods | Voice, Gesture, Eye-tracking | Voice Only | Voice, Touch |
Battery Life | 12 Hours | 10 Hours | 8 Hours |
Use Cases and Real-World Applications
The versatility of NeuralLink AI Assistant is evident in diverse scenarios:
- Home Automation: Effortlessly control lighting, security systems, and entertainment devices with customized routines based on time of day or user presence.
- Workplace Productivity: Automate scheduling, take real-time meeting notes, and manage emails across multiple accounts with natural language commands.
- Healthcare Monitoring: Track vital signs and medication schedules, providing timely alerts and telehealth integration for improved patient care.
- Education: Assist students and educators with personalized study plans, interactive learning tools, and real-time language translations.
- Mobility Assistance: Supports users with disabilities through customizable control schemes and integration with assistive technologies.
